All Hands on Deck

City of Sheridan street crews worked long hours during the big snowstorm that occurred in mid December. Sheridan Media’s Ron Richter has more.
It was “all hands on deck” when winter storm Diaz hit Sheridan during the mid part of December. Sheridan Mayor Rich Bridger says crews worked round the clock in an effort to keep the main streets clear and drivable.
Mayor Bridger says they are aware that there may be some flooding issues in certain parts of the city.
The Mayor also talked about the snow patrol program through the Hub on Smith.
